I have just noticed that there is a subtle difference between the labels of my two promo 45 copies for this song. Both copies state run times of (4:14). One has deadwax of "ZSS-167472 1C", while the other's is "ZSS-167472 -2C". But the latter copy's label states "Re-Mastered for Radio". It is positioned below the label's time/publishing info, and above the song title's word "Swamp" on the label's right side, in small, non-bold print. This phrase was also hand-circled in pen.
